KITTITAS COUNTY <br />D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C WORKS <br />PUBLIC WORKS — BOARD OF COUNTY COMMISSIONERS <br />STUDY SESSION STAFF REPORT <br />STUDY SESSION DATE: August 12, 2024 <br />TOPIC: Airport Lease Approval <br />ACTION REQUESTED: Direct Staff <br />LEAD STAFF: <br />Joshua Fredrickson <br />RECOMMENDATION: <br />Direct Staff to develop enabling documents. <br />BRIEFING SUMMARY: <br />• Public Works oversees the Airport as a Division of the Department <br />• KCC 2.81.060(4) authorizes approval authority to be delegated to a designee <br />• Previous resolutions authorized the Airport Director to execute lease agreements <br />for T-Hangars and short-term leases <br />BACKGROUND: <br />Kittitas County is the airport sponsor of Bowers Field with Public Works having the <br />responsibility to manage leases for County owned land and structures including T- <br />hangars. Kittitas County Code 2.81.060(4) authorizes lease approvals to be delegated by <br />resolution. Lease types at the airport include T-Hangar, land and agricultural. <br />Occasionally short-term leases, less than 1-year duration, are requested. Previous <br />approval by the Board (Resolutions 2023-045 and 2023-114) authorized the Airport <br />Director to execute T-Hangar and short-term lease agreements. <br />DISCUSSION: <br />Current lease agreements require Board action to approve. Bowers Field Airport leases, <br />including T-hangars and short-term leases are included. T-Hangar leases are a standard <br />lease and rate previously approved. To process T-Hangar and short-term leases in an <br />efficient and short duration, Public Works has the capacity and knowledge necessary to <br />evaluate and execute T-Hangar lease agreements for those agreements which the terms <br />and conditions have been previously reviewed and approved to form. This includes T- <br />Hangar and short-term leases. Authorizing the Public Works Director the limited lease <br />authority will allow for timely leases. <br />FISCAL IMPACT: <br />Authorizing the Public Works Director to address limited lease amendments will reduce <br />time expenditure in staff time as well as costs of posting notices for public hearings. <br />ATTACHMENTS: <br />None <br />
